— Unknown, shared by Cory WaldnerThe Holy Spirit doesn’t just live in you — it changes you. Here are the fruits that grow when you walk in the Spirit:
Love
Selfless, unconditional — agape love
Joy
Gladness not based on circumstances
Peace
Harmonious wellbeing, freedom from disputes
Patience
Enduring hardship without anger
Kindness
Acts of goodness and generosity
Goodness
Morally upright, reflects God’s character
Faithfulness
Trustworthy, reliable, and loyal
Gentleness
Mild and considerate in actions and words
Self-Control
Restraining impulses and desires
